This week I share the first birth story under the new title "Birth Back Then". Mairead revisits each of her three miscarriages followed by her two birth stories. Mairead worked as a nurse all her life so gives us an insight into what that looked like along with how life looked in the 1980's as a working women trying to build her family. She gave birth to her first son unmedicated with the support of her husband within the hospital setting. We then move onto her second birth story which was very different. She was blighted with constant sickness and crippling pain. It was discovered at 26 weeks gestation that Mairead infact had a huge cyst along with other diagnosis and underwent emergency surgery.
Mairead then takes us through life post surgery and the remainder of her pregnancy. It's so hard to her how after such a short space of time her life returned to "normal", working for as long as she could until she went into labour while still very much feeling the impact of her surgery.
Mairead's story is precisely why I decided to make this addition to the podcast and open the space up for women to share their historical births.
